Asa Butterfield, Molly Windsor Set for Netflix Show 'Out of the Dust'

Starring Asa Butterfield from "Sex Education," Molly Windsor of "Three Girls," Fra Fee from "Hawkeye," Siobhan Finneran in "Time," and Christopher Eccleston renowned for "True Detective," Netflix introduces a gripping new psychological thriller, "Out of the Dust," penned by the talented Julie Gearey, the mind behind "Intergalactic."

This edge-of-your-seat tale unfolds within the confines of a rigid Christian sect, where Rosie (Windsor), a devoted wife and mother, embarks on a perilous journey of liberation and sexual enlightenment after a fateful encounter with Sam (Fee), an escaped convict. Butterfield takes on the role of Adam, while Finneran and Eccleston portray Mrs. and Mr. Phillips, respectively, in this six-episode odyssey produced by Double Dutch Productions, a Banijay U.K. affiliate.

"Rosie resides in a secluded Christian enclave with her husband Adam and daughter, where life follows a prescribed path," the narrative teases. "The unexpected intrusion of Sam, a fugitive from justice, shatters the veil of her world, exposing its true nature and constraints. Could this hidden religious community be harboring darker intentions? As cracks emerge in her marriage, Sam presents himself as a beacon of hope. Yet, with his own sordid criminal past, where does the greatest peril lie—within the cult's walls or with Sam himself?"

Filming has commenced this month in the U.K., under the expert direction of Jim Loach, known for "Criminal Record," and Philippa Langdale, whose credits include "A Discovery of Witches." Iona Vrolyk and Myar Craig-Brown serve as executive producers for Double Dutch Productions, alongside Julie Gearey, while Nick Pitt oversees production. Established by Vrolyk in 2022 with Banijay U.K.'s backing, "Out of the Dust" marks Double Dutch Productions' maiden commission, promising a thrilling ride that delves deep into the heart of human desires and the lengths one will go to find freedom.
